what are the differences between 301+ and 360?
...
for starter, can 301+ run program/plugin like 360?
301
- 6" screen,
- only 5way d-pad - not two big pageturning buttons),
- jack for headphones - you can listen to mp3,
- does not have acclerometer - the screen does not flip automatically when you tilt the device,
- does not have lid

360
- 5" screen - it has the same number of pixels, so the firmware is identical (screen-wise) to 301
- two more big pageturning buttons
- does not have audio jack
- does have accelerometer. You can switch it off if you read in bed or in various non-vertical positions
- does have lid

Firmware is almost identical. I believe it is compiled from the same source code as 360. It goes so far, that in 360 firmware you can map volume up and volume down despite the fact that 360 does not have audio playing HW ;-)

So, 301 can do everything 360 can, plus it can play mp3.
Here on Mobileread 360 is more frequently discussed, but on Russian speaking forum http://www.the-ebook.org/forum/viewforum.php?f=32 where 360 was born, 301 is more discussed, because it is much older.
